State of the Region
It was an honor to attend State of the Region hosted by SWFL Inc. CEO and Rep. Tiffany Esposito. Several hundred community leaders were present at the event to listen to speakers from across the state discuss workforce development, workforce housing, and water quality. It was great to hear from Secretary of Commerce Alex Kelly, Secretary of the Florida Department of Transportation Jared Perdue, Rep. Tiffany Esposito, and various other Florida business leaders.
Here are some key takeaways from the conference:
Florida is ranked # 1 in the nation in job growth.
Florida is the most business friendly state in the nation.
Florida’s unemployment rate is below the national average at 2.7%.
Florida had over 130 million visitors last year.
Florida is rated #1 in elementary, secondary and university education.
Florida has the strongest credit rating in the nation.
Florida has had over 2.5 million new business formations in the last four years.
Florida’s economy, if standing alone, would be the 14th largest in the world.

Never Forget
On September 11, 2001, the world witnessed a devastating act of terrorism that forever changed the course of history. The attacks on the World Trade Center in New York City, the Pentagon in Washington, D.C., and the hijacked plane that crashed in Pennsylvania claimed the lives of nearly 3,000 innocent people. In the face of unimaginable horror, countless acts of bravery, selflessness, and resilience emerged. Firefighters, police officers, and other first responders risked their lives to save others, demonstrating the true meaning of heroism. Ordinary citizens also stepped up, offering support and compassion in the midst of chaos and uncertainty. Our thoughts today are with those who were tragically taken from us on 9/11.
